Ghulam Rasool Santosh (1929-1997)

Untitled
signed 'Santosh' in Devanagiri lower left, circa late 1960s
oil on canvas, framed
75.6 x 75.6cm (29 3/4 x 29 3/4in).

Footnotes

Provenance
Property from a private collection, Italy.

Gulam Rasool Santosh's career can be divided into four clearly defined segments during which he painted landscapes, figures, abstracts and neo-tantric art. While he is commonly associated with the last, it is not usually equated with his interest in abstraction because of the presence in these works of yogic figures that suggest the creation and effulgence of spiritual awakening. It is in the brief interlude during which he painted abstracts as a precursor to his concern with tantrism, that he combined the academic language of art with his own rising interest in Shaivite philosophy. At first, there might appear little in common between his abstract and tantric phases, but on closer inspection the abstract serves as a direct bridge in that direction. A departure from the cubist figures he was partial to, there is a suggestion in these works of the shapes and forms, the script as it were, of the Harappan inscriptions and the Shaivite symbols that he saw inscribed on a rock in Kashmir, that forms the basis of his new language. In these experimental works, he was still to arrive at his destination - these, then, being markers to that journey.' (Indian Abstracts: An absence of form, Delhi Art Gallery, 2014, pg. 355)
